  • I have a peanut shell, a moby and an ergo.  Ergo is by far the easiest to put on and is very comfortable, and I don't worry about DD's feet getting squished or legs torqued because she basically straddles my middle.  In fact she's asleep in it right now :)

    The moby was awesome when she was teeny because it could be tightened to fit her 7 pound body.  Now that she's basically double that, the ergo is great.
